What does Eagers Automotive do? Eagers Automotive Ltd is an Australian company that specializes in the sale and maintenance of cars. The company covers all major segments of the automotive market and offers both new and used vehicles. The company's history dates back to 1913 when it was established as part of the Queensland Motor Exchange. The company quickly established itself as the primary car dealer in Queensland and soon expanded its business to the rest of the country. Today, Eagers has over 220 branches in Australia and New Zealand and is a major player in the automotive industry. Eagers Automotive's business model is based on the idea of offering its customers a wide range of car brands and models. The company operates in three main business areas: sale of new and used cars, financial services, and repair and maintenance services. Eagers is an authorized dealer for leading car manufacturers such as Toyota, Ford, and Hyundai. The company also offers specialized vehicles such as trucks, buses, and SUVs. In recent years, Eagers has also established an increased presence in the luxury car market. The company has branches specializing in the sale of premium vehicles, such as Porsche, Audi, and Mercedes-Benz. In addition to car sales, Eagers also offers financial services such as car financing and contract deliveries. To simplify the financing of new cars, the company has been merged with Toyota Financial Services to offer customized financing solutions for customers. Another important business area of Eagers is vehicle repair and maintenance. The company maintains an extensive workshop infrastructure to offer repair services. The company's workshops also act as authorized dealers for major insurance companies and take on repair orders from customers who have damage to their vehicles. Eagers also presents an after-sales program that offers comprehensive maintenance and repair services, as well as parts and accessories for cars of all brands. In 2018, Eagers Automotive also introduced an online marketplace called Carzoos, which allows customers to buy used cars without physically inspecting them. The company had already expanded its online offerings to facilitate car purchases. Carzoos is another step in expanding the company's online presence, allowing customers to select, purchase, and finance cars online. Analyzing Eagers Automotive's EBIT

Eagers Automotive's Earnings Before Interest and Taxes (EBIT) represents the company's operating profit. It is calculated by deducting all operating expenses, including the cost of goods sold (COGS) and operating expenses, from the total revenue, but before accounting for interest and taxes. It provides insights into the company’s operational profitability, excluding the impacts of financing and tax structures.
